About Me

Annie Dawid writes and makes art in the Wet Mountain Valley of South-Central Colorado after retiring early from Lewis & Clark College in Portland, Oregon, where she was Professor of English and directed the creative writing program for 15 years.


Her third book, AND DARKNESS WAS UNDER HIS FEET: STORIES OF A FAMILY, was most recently reviewed in Jewish Book World, Winter 2009. It won the Litchfield Review Award for Short Fiction and was a finalist in the Indie Book Awards in the Short Story category. DARKNESS as well as Annie's other two books, LILY IN THE DESERT: STORIES and YORK FERRY: A NOVEL, are available on amazon.com and other venues.
